Starwest Botanicals Recalls Organic Cardamom Pods Due to Salmonella Risk
Starwest Botanicals is recalling organic cardamom pods after a customer reported a positive Salmonella test result for a specific bulk lot.

Plain-English summary
Starwest Botanicals, Inc. is recalling specific lots of Cardamom Pods Green Whole Organic. The recall was initiated after a customer notified the firm of a positive test result for Salmonella in Lot #90186-00. The affected product was imported from Guatemala and is sold in 25 lb. bulk boxes and 1 lb. retail plastic bags.
The recall involves 810 pounds of bulk product and 133 one-pound bags. The bulk product is identified by Lot #90186-00 and Item number 1, while the 1 lb. bags are identified by Lot 75593 and Item number 209735-01. The product was distributed in the US and Canada.
Consumers who purchased these specific lots should stop using the product and contact Starwest Botanicals for instructions on disposal or return. The FDA classifies this as a Class I recall, indicating a reasonable probability that the use of, or exposure to, the violative product will cause serious adverse health consequences or death.
